Motion of the relativistic center of mass of the two-body system in the environment

Abstract: The motion equations for a system of two bodies moving in a medium are derived in the Cartesian coordinate system in the Newtonian theory. The coordinate system is barycentric, that is, the center of mass of the two-body system is immobile.
